Two Paternoster bus stops are attracting huge attention. Organised by Paternoster Operative, a community volunteer organisation committed to the overall improvement of the village, the bus stops have been transformed from graffiti-covered eyesores into vibrant outdoor art pieces – created by talented local artists. The most recent makeover was done at the bus stop in Kliprug.
Initiated by Cindy Saville, Paternoster Operative is renowned for its proactive litter clearing campaign across the village. “Everything we do is a team effort – none of this could happen without our volunteers, sponsors and donors. All credit goes to them for showing such community spirit and social investment in our special little town.”
The work necessary to transform the bus stops was extensive, and locals stepped up to the challenge. “Fixing the children’s park is next, and the more money raised, the more we can do.”
